Helpful Tips:
Start your yeast before adding to the rest of the ingredients is a good way to test if you yeast is alive or viable. Sprinkle yeast into one-quarter cup of lukewarm water and 1 tablespoon of flour and a teaspoon of sugar, stir and let allow to rest for 5 minutes. Yeast mixture should be bubbly and foamy if the yeast mixture does not start to bubble within five to ten minutes; your yeast is dead or enervated. Throw away and start over with fresh yeast.
